免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

前端移动网页开发怎么变成app

前端移动网页开发变成app的方法有两种,一种是基于webview封装成Hybrid App,另一种是使用React Native或Ionic等框架进行开发。

1. 基于webview封装成Hybrid App

Hybrid App是指将web技术和Native技术结合起来的应用程序,主要使用webview展示页面,同时也可以访问设备的一些硬件功能。开发Hybrid App的优势在于可以快速实现跨平台开发,使用web技术开发页面,同时也可以利用Native技术调用硬件功能,提升用户体验。

实现Hybrid App的方法是将前端网页代码封装成Native应用,主要分为以下几个步骤:

(1)使用Cordova等Hybrid App框架,创建一个Native应用项目。

(2)在项目中添加webview组件,将前端网页代码嵌入到webview中。

(3)调用原生API,实现与设备硬件的交互。

(4)发布应用到App Store或Google Play等应用商店。

2. 使用React Native或Ionic等框架进行开发

React Native和Ionic都是目前比较流行的跨平台移动应用开发框架,使用这些框架可以使用JavaScript语言开发Native应用,同时可以实现跨平台开发。

React Native是Facebook开发的框架,可以使用JavaScript语言开发iOS和Android应用,实现了高效的渲染和响应速度。

Ionic是一款基于AngularJS框架的开源移动应用框架,可以使用HTML、CSS和JavaScript语言开发iOS和Android应用。

使用这些框架进行开发,主要分为以下几个步骤:

(1)安装React Native或Ionic等框架。

(2)创建一个新的应用程序,并进行基本的配置。

(3)使用JavaScript编写应用程序的业务逻辑和界面。

(4)将应用程序编译成Native代码,并进行测试和调试。

(5)发布应用到App Store或Google Play等应用商店。

总体来说,无论是基于webview封装成Hybrid App还是使用React Native或Ionic等框架进行开发,都可以将前端移动网页变成app,并实现跨平台开发。开发者可以根据自己的需求和技术水平选择不同的方法。


相关知识:
网站及app开发
网站和app开发是现代科技的一个重要组成部分,涉及到的知识领域非常广泛。在本文中,我们将会对网站和app开发的原理和详细介绍进行阐述。一、网站开发网站是指在互联网上发布信息、提供服务的一个虚拟空间。它由前端页面和后台数据处理程序组成。前端页面指的是用户在浏
2024-03-06
开发新闻网站app
随着移动设备的普及,越来越多的人开始使用手机来获取新闻资讯。因此,开发一款新闻网站的移动应用程序(app)是很有必要的。下面,我将介绍开发一款新闻网站app的原理和步骤。一、需求分析在开发一个新闻网站app之前,我们需要先进行需求分析,明确用户需求和功能需
2024-03-06
安卓网页客户端app制作
安卓网页客户端app是一种基于Web技术的应用程序,可以将Web应用程序打包成一个独立的安卓应用程序,以提供更好的用户体验和更高的使用频率。本文将介绍安卓网页客户端app的制作原理和详细步骤。一、安卓网页客户端app的原理安卓网页客户端app原理基于Web
2024-03-06
如何做个比赛比分网站app
做一个比赛比分网站App需要考虑到很多方面,包括数据来源、数据存储、数据更新、用户界面设计等等。下面将从这些方面介绍如何做一个比赛比分网站App。1. 数据来源比赛比分网站App需要获取比赛数据,这些数据可以从官方体育网站、体育新闻网站或者专门提供比赛数据
2024-03-06
app购物网站开发
随着移动互联网的普及,越来越多的人开始通过手机进行购物。因此,开发一款购物类的APP已经成为了很多企业的必然选择。下面,我们就来详细介绍一下APP购物网站的开发原理。一、需求分析在开发购物APP之前,首先需要进行需求分析,明确开发目标和用户需求。需要考虑以
2024-03-06
app网站制作专业开发定制
App网站制作是一种专业的开发技术,它能够帮助企业和个人快速地建立一个高效的移动端网站,为用户提供方便快捷的浏览体验。在移动互联网时代,App网站的重要性越来越受到人们的关注,因此,掌握App网站制作技术,对于企业和个人来说都是非常有益的。一、App网站制
2024-03-06